Monitor multiple dashboard usage metrics for multiple workspaces for more than 30 days

Hi Gurus!

 

I have been navigating through various posts over the last few days on the forum and internet without any straightforward success.

 

Can you please help me with the following:

 

We have 4 Workspaces (all of them "Pro") which house 5-15 Dashboards each.

Is there a way to pull usage data of each dashboard from each workspace and present the stats through another dashboard?

 

All workspaces are at Pro capacity, I am the "admin" on all 4, BUT I am not the IT admin (ms365) on any.

 

Looking for an automated way to pull the data, stored them somewhere and then connect to these data for a "Dashboard usage" dashboard. Would like to stack month over month indefinately.

 

Any ideas?

Hi @IoannisT ,

 

From what I understand, it's necessary to have tenant level admin to get the ‘ViewDashboard’ in the audit activity event using the power bi rest api:

Admin - Get Activity Events - REST API (Power BI Power BI REST APIs) | Microsoft Learn

 

In addition, consider using powershell or power automate etc. for automated auditing processes:

 

Power BI implementation planning: Tenant-level auditing - Power BI | Microsoft Learn

 

Access the Power BI activity log - Power BI | Microsoft Learn
